Showing: 2,149 results for Gas Station
near Charlton, MA
Filter by
- Distance
- Rating
Search results
Exxon Service Station
Gas Station

Massachusetts Turnpike,
Charlton, MA 01507
Exxon Service Station
Gas Station

36-38 Worcester Road,
Charlton, MA 01507
Nouria Energy Corporation
Gas Station, Convenience Store
BBB Rating: A
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business Profile
138 Southbridge Street,
North Oxford, MA 01537

6 Oxford Ave,
Dudley, MA 01571
Daou's Automotive
Auto Repairs, Used Car Dealers, Towing Company 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business Profile
173 Main St,
Sturbridge, MA 01566-1259

P.o. Box 126,
Sturbridge, MA 01566

149 Charlton Road,
Sturbridge, MA 01566

365 Main St,
Sturbridge, MA 01566-2329
Peterson Oil Service, Inc.
Fuel Oil, Heating and Air Conditioning, Residential Air Conditioning Contractors ...
BBB Rating: C-
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business Profile
895 Main St,
Southbridge, MA 01550-1119
Petro Max
Gas Station

904 Main St,
Southbridge, MA 01550-1143

755 Worcester St,
Southbridge, MA 01550-1383
Daou's Automotive
Auto Repairs, Used Car Dealers, Towing Company ...
BBB Rating: A+
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business Profile
736 Worcester St.,
Southbridge, MA 01550
La Flamme's Citgo Service Station
Gas Station

232 East Main Street,
East Brookfield, MA 01515
La Flamme's Citgo Service Station
Gas Station

PO Box 237,
East Brookfield, MA 01515
Nouria Energy Corporation
Gas Station, Convenience Store
BBB Rating: A
This rating reflects BBB's opinion about the entire organization's interactions with its customers, including interactions with local locations.
View HQ Business Profile
611 Southbridge Street,
Auburn, MA 01501
Related Categories
Accreditation and Ratings Overview
Select businesses earn BBB Accreditation by undergoing a thorough evaluation and upholding the BBB Accreditation Standards.
BBB assigns ratings from A+ (highest) to F (lowest). In some cases, BBB will not rate the business (indicated by an NR, or "No Rating") for reasons that include insufficient information about a business or ongoing review/update of the business's file.
Didn't find the business you were looking for?
If the business you're looking for isn't in our directory, submit a request to have it added.